Detailed Architectural/Principle Analysis

The Servo rotating fixture stamping machine is engineered as a flexible, high-performance platform. Because standard configurations do not always meet the unique communication protocols of modern smart factories, the system architecture is designed to support custom PLC integration. This modification allows the stamping machine to communicate directly with centralized factory management systems, MES software, and auxiliary robotics.

Servo rotating fixture stamping machine main unit showcasing robust construction

During the design phase, our engineering team maps out the I/O requirements and bus communication protocols (such as Modbus, Profinet, or EtherCAT) specified by the client. This level of customization ensures that the servo drives and the rotating fixture respond with millisecond-level precision to the custom PLC commands. Such integration has been successfully deployed in various international projects, including high-demand commercial supply operations in Saudi Arabia, where precise brand logo customization on diverse materials requires flawless synchronization between the fixture rotation and the embossing head.

Data/Solution Comparison

Feature / Parameter Standard Configuration Custom PLC Integrated Configuration
Control System Flexibility Fixed proprietary controller Fully customizable (Siemens, Mitsubishi, Omron, etc.)
Upstream/Downstream Integration Manual or basic I/O linking Advanced industrial bus protocol synchronization
Warranty Period Two years Two years (with lifetime technical maintenance)
Delivery Lead Time Standard equipment: 48 hours Custom non-standard: 20 working days / up to 1 month
Quality Verification Standard performance testing Installation acceptance, commissioning, and structural safety inspection

Frequently Asked Questions (FAQ)

Q1: What is the lead time for a Servo rotating fixture stamping machine with a custom PLC?

A1: Customized non-standard machines typically require 20 working days to manufacture, depending on the complexity of the programming and physical integration. The maximum delivery window for highly customized non-standard equipment is one month.

Q2: How is the after-sales support managed for customized control software?

A2: We provide a two-year warranty for the main product along with one-on-one remote technical teaching. Our engineering team offers lifetime maintenance and remote guidance to assist with debugging, process parameter optimization, and PLC troubleshooting.

Q3: Can the machine be shipped safely overseas after custom modifications?

A3: Yes. All completed machinery is securely packaged in reinforced wooden boxes to prevent moisture and impact damage during transit. We support FBA sea, air, and land freight, providing full tracking updates at every stage of the shipping process.
